Vision
SAFE in Northern Michigan is working on creating environments free of substance use.
Mission
SAFE in Northern Michigan exists to prevent youth substance use, increase community awareness and create change through collaboration, education, prevention initiatives and environmental strategies of tobacco, alcohol and other substance use in Antrim, Charlevoix and Emmet counties.

County Prevention Initiatives and Accomplishments
Our coalition graduated from CADCA’s National Coalition Institute and we understand the importance’s of doing evidence based programing. Our coalition does a comprehensive approach and includes strategies in all seven areas of the behavior change model. Please visit our website for more detailed information, www.SAFEinNM.com.
